Profound. Age-worthy. Romagna's flagship red, redefined.
From the rolling hills of Ravenna, the fully organic Randi estate crafts Burson Ravenna Rosso Selezione as a crowning expression of their terroir. Made 100% from Longanesi grapes, this top-tier red benefits from 24 months of careful ageing in fine oak, allowing structure, depth, and aromatic elegance to emerge fully. Each bottle reflects meticulous vineyard management, patience, and a deep respect for the character of Emilia-Romagna.

In the glass, Burson shows a deep garnet-red hue, hinting at its concentration and power. The nose opens with intense aromas of black cherries, plums, dried herbs, leather, and subtle spicy notes, with a whisper of oak and mineral complexity. On the palate, the wine is full-bodied yet refined: layered dark fruit, silky tannins, and a mineral lift provide both depth and poise. The long oak ageing integrates seamlessly, giving a lingering, elegant finish that rewards slow enjoyment.

This is a wine to savor with special dishes: aged meats, slow-roasted game, rich pasta, or mature cheeses. On Irish tables, it brings sophistication, balance, and a true sense of place, embodying the best of Randi’s dedication to Longanesi and organic winemaking.

24 months in French oak tonneaux followed by 12 months bottle refinement.

Randi Vini, a family-run organic estate in Fusignano, is at the forefront of Romagna’s indigenous grape renaissance. Their work with Longanesi (aka Burson) has made them a benchmark for the variety. The Riserva “Etichetta Nera” is their flagship — produced only in exceptional vintages and in limited quantities.
